Paxton Weather in October
October in Paxton sees daytime temperatures around 25°C (77°F) and lows of 12°C (54°F) at night. With around 62 mm (2.4 in) of rainfall expected, it's worth packing a rain jacket.
Rainfall in Paxton in October
The climate data from previous years indicates about 11 days of rain, averaging 62 mm (2.4 in) for the month. Rain this month is fairly typical, a standard mix of wet and dry days with no particularly heavy or persistent showers.
Temperature in Paxton in October
Weather in Paxton is at its perfect in October. Highs reach 25°C (77°F), while nights settle around 12°C (54°F). The days can feel warmer than the evenings, so packing for both parts of the day is a good idea. At 12°C (54°F) overnight, it can feel quite a bit cooler after dark. Worth packing something warmer for evenings, but the cooler temperatures are ideal for sleeping.So this is a great month to visit if you prefer dry days with pleasant temperatures.
